About Concern Australia

Concern Australia works in partnership with young people and their families to create positive opportunities and hopeful futures. Our programs provide education, employment, housing, youth justice and homelessness services. We focus on innovative and empowering pathways which build on young people’s talents and resilience and support them to reach their goals.

The fiXit Social Enterprise is an automotive business which also provides opportunities for young people to gain work experience and skills through short term employment. fiXit receives 100-200 donated cars from the community each year, which fiXit repurposes for profit. We also provide trustworthy servicing and repairs.

About the role

This role coordinates the day-to-day operations of fiXit, enabling our business to provide a safe and trustworthy service to our community.

Accredited by Social Traders, fiXit social enterprise provides a service to the local community through the provision of service and repair of vehicles and the collection of donated vehicles for restoration and sale.

You will also be working in collaboration with the Hand Brake Turn program, a pre-vocational 5-week automotive course. On an ad hoc basis, you will provide practical, hands-on automotive training experience to young people between 15-25 years old to transition into education and employment pathways.

This position is classified in accordance with the Manufacturing and Associated Industries and Occupations Award 2020, Modern award MA000010.
